Transaction 63eaf112e58bc83bfd05b3d5ef4cf84dbe003d5b9508250f757f8244c19b7fa2

1 Input
2 Outputs
  • 63eaf112e58bc83bfd05b3d5ef4cf84dbe003d5b9508250f757f8244c19b7fa2:0
  • value  168618
    address  1LtFgN2DR5oSopE6FD6Not8hseFDegAnvM
  • 63eaf112e58bc83bfd05b3d5ef4cf84dbe003d5b9508250f757f8244c19b7fa2:1
  • value  20364313
    address  3ERNPwfyTQbL2XAq75oGJYaj5AuhBEe64m